1. 项目背景与核心价值
这个8音电子琴项目是电子工程入门教学的经典案例。作为韶关学院自动化协会的首次培训内容,它完美融合了模拟电路基础、数字信号处理和嵌入式系统概念。NE555定时器作为核心元件,其灵活性和稳定性使其成为电子设计初学者的理想选择。
我在大学电子设计竞赛指导中发现,超过70%的参赛选手的第一个完整电路项目都是基于NE555的音调发生器。这种电路不仅能让学生理解RC振荡原理,还能通过实际听觉反馈快速验证电路功能,极大提升学习成就感。
2. 核心电路设计解析
2.1 NE555工作模式选择
我们采用NE555的无稳态工作模式(Astable Mode)来产生方波信号。这个模式下,芯片不需要外部触发就能持续振荡,其频率由外部电阻和电容决定:
code复制f = 1.44 / ((R1 + 2*R2) * C)
实际调试时有个小技巧:先用10kΩ电位器代替固定电阻,配合示波器调整到目标频率后,再测量电位器阻值选用最接近的标准电阻。这样能避免繁琐的理论计算和元件采购难题。
2.2 音阶频率配置
八度音阶中各音的频率遵循十二平均律。以中音C(C4)为例:
| 音名 | C4 | D4 | E4 | F4 | G4 | A4 | B4 | C5 |
|---|---|---|---|---|---|---|---|---|
| 频率(Hz) | 261.63 | 293.66 | 329.63 | 349.23 | 392.00 | 440.00 | 493.88 | 523.25 |
在面包板搭建时,建议先用Excel计算出各音阶对应的RC参数组合,制成参考表格贴在实验台前。我通常会预留5%的调整余量,因为电解电容的实际容值往往有偏差。
3. 硬件搭建要点
3.1 元件选型建议
- NE555芯片:推荐使用NE555P(DIP封装)而非表面贴装型号,便于面包板实验
- 电容选择:主振荡电容建议用涤纶电容(如CL21系列),其温度稳定性优于瓷片电容
- 按键开关:选用6×6mm轻触开关,注意要并联0.1μF消抖电容
- 扬声器:8Ω/0.5W的微型扬声器即可,过大功率需要增加驱动三极管
3.2 电路布局技巧
在培训中我发现,90%的电路不发声问题都源于布局不当。推荐这种走线方案:
- 电源总线:在面包板两侧纵向布置VCC和GND总线
- 星型接地:所有GND连接都直接接到电源总线,避免串联接地
- 信号流向:保持555输出→电阻网络→按键→扬声器的直线路径
- 去耦电容:在555的VCC和GND引脚间放置100nF瓷片电容
关键提示:用不同颜色的跳线区分功能模块(红色-电源,黑色-地线,黄色-音频信号),这能大幅降低后续调试难度。
4. 典型问题排查指南
根据五年培训经验,整理出这个项目最常见的三个问题:
| 现象 | 可能原因 | 解决方案 |
|---|---|---|
| 完全无声 | 电源接反/未接通 | 用万用表检查VCC-GND间电压 |
| 音调不准 | RC参数偏差 | 更换5%精度金属膜电阻 |
| 按键卡顿 | 触点氧化 | 用酒精清洗或更换开关 |
| 杂音大 | 接地不良 | 检查星型接地连接 |
| 发热严重 | 输出短路 | 断开扬声器测量555输出端电压 |
有个学员的典型案例:电路能发声但音调全部偏高10%。检查发现他误用了103(10nF)电容而非标注的104(100nF)。这种问题用示波器看波形周期就能立即定位。
5. 扩展改进方向
基础电路调试成功后,可以引导学员尝试这些进阶改造:
- 音量控制:在扬声器回路串联10kΩ电位器
- 音色调整:在输出端加入RC低通滤波器(如1kΩ+100nF)
- 节拍功能:用另一个555制作1Hz的LED节奏指示
- 曲目存储:外接Arduino实现自动演奏
去年有个优秀学员作品给我留下深刻印象:他用CD4017十进制计数器实现了简单的旋律循环,通过拨码开关选择预设曲目。这种创新正是电子设计教学的终极目标。
6. 培训实施建议
根据多次培训经验,建议按这个节奏开展:
第一阶段(60分钟)
- 讲解555定时器原理(配合示波器演示)
- 搭建单音发生器电路
- 测量并记录各元件参数
第二阶段(90分钟)
- 扩展为完整8音电路
- 分组调试音准
- 简单曲目练习(如《小星星》)
第三阶段(30分钟)
- 故障模拟与排除训练
- 优秀作品展示
- 进阶方案讨论
记得准备些小奖品奖励最先完成功能的小组,这种竞争机制能显著提升学员积极性。我通常会准备些实用工具如多功能螺丝刀或元件盒作为奖励。